Abstract

The invention discloses a Bluetooth pairing information deleting method, a set top box and a storage medium, wherein the method comprises the following steps: detecting the action times of plugging and unplugging the signal connecting line into the set top box; and when the action times are more than or equal to the set times, deleting the Bluetooth pairing information of the set top box and the Bluetooth remote controller stored in the set top box. The invention realizes that when the Bluetooth remote controller which establishes Bluetooth connection with the set-top box can not operate the set-top box, the Bluetooth pairing information stored in the set-top box is deleted by plugging the signal connecting line of the set-top box, thereby facilitating the user to reuse a new Bluetooth remote controller to operate the set-top box.

Background
A Set-Top Box (also called a Set Top Box, abbreviated as STB) is a device for connecting a television Set and an external signal source, and can convert a compressed digital signal into television content and display the television content on the television Set.
At present, after the Bluetooth remote controller is connected with the set top box in a Bluetooth mode, when the Bluetooth remote controller is lost or damaged and a new Bluetooth remote controller needs to be replaced, the Bluetooth remote controller which is originally connected with the set top box in the Bluetooth mode cannot be used, a user cannot operate the set top box, Bluetooth pairing information stored in the set top box cannot be deleted, and therefore the new Bluetooth remote controller cannot be paired with the set top box and cannot be used.

Embodiments of the present invention provide an embodiment of a bluetooth pairing information deletion method, and it should be noted that although a logical order is shown in the flowchart, in some cases, the steps shown or described may be performed in an order different from that here.
As shown in fig. 2, in the first embodiment of the present application, the bluetooth pairing information deleting method of the present application is applied to a set top box accessing to a terminal device, where the terminal device may be a television; the method for deleting the Bluetooth pairing information comprises the following steps:
step S210: and detecting the action times of plugging and unplugging the signal connecting line into the set top box.
Step S220: judging whether the action times is greater than or equal to a set time, if so, executing step S230; if not, the process returns to the step S210.
Step S230: and deleting the Bluetooth pairing information of the set top box and the Bluetooth remote controller stored in the set top box.
The existing set top box has a Bluetooth function, and after the set top box is connected with a television, a user needs to operate the television through a Bluetooth remote controller in advance if the user wants to operate the television, so that the Bluetooth remote controller and the set top box are subjected to Bluetooth pairing. After the Bluetooth remote controller is successfully paired with the set top box, the Bluetooth pairing information of the Bluetooth remote controller and the set top box is stored in the set top box. If another Bluetooth remote controller is used for being accompanied with the set top box at present, because the Bluetooth pairing information is stored in the set top box, namely the Bluetooth connection is established between the Bluetooth remote controller and the set top box, the currently used Bluetooth remote controller cannot establish the Bluetooth connection with the set top box, if a user does not want to continue to use the Bluetooth remote controller establishing the Bluetooth connection with the set top box and wants to use a new Bluetooth remote controller, the Bluetooth remote controller establishing the Bluetooth connection with the set top box can be used for operating the set top box, the Bluetooth pairing information stored in the set top box is deleted, and therefore the pairing between the set top box and the set top box is released. After the Bluetooth pairing information stored in the set top box is deleted, the new Bluetooth remote controller can be paired with the set top box, after the pairing is successful, Bluetooth connection is established between the new Bluetooth remote controller and the set top box, and the Bluetooth pairing information of the new Bluetooth remote controller and the set top box can be stored in the set top box.
In this embodiment, in consideration of the situation that the bluetooth remote controller connected to the set top box via bluetooth may be damaged or lost, which may result in the user being unable to operate the set top box, the bluetooth pairing information of the set top box and the bluetooth remote controller stored in the set top box is deleted by repeatedly plugging and unplugging the signal connection line of the set top box by the user. The signal connection line is generally an HDMI line, and if the set-top box has a network cable socket or interface, the signal connection line may also be a network cable.
Specifically, after the set top box starts, the number of times of actions of inserting and pulling the signal connecting line into the set top box is repeatedly detected in real time. Generally, after a set-top box is connected with a television, a signal connecting line is plugged in a plug wire port of the set-top box, and plugging and unplugging the signal connecting line connected to the set-top box means that the signal connecting line is unplugged from the plug wire port of the signal connecting line and then the unplugged signal connecting line is plugged into the plug wire port, wherein the unplugging of the signal connecting line from the plug wire port of the signal connecting line and the plugging of the unplugged signal connecting line into the plug wire port are a complete plugging and unplugging action, and the action times are one time. For example, a user plugs an HDMI cable from an HDMI cable socket, and then plugs the HDMI cable into the HDMI cable socket again, which is a plugging action with one action time; if the user pulls out and inserts the HDMI cable from the HDMI cable plugging port once and then inserts the HDMI cable into the HDMI cable plugging port again, the action times are twice.
The set number of times is a preset value and is used for judging whether the Bluetooth pairing information stored in the set top box is deleted or not. And if the action times of the plugging and unplugging actions of the plugging and unplugging signal connecting lines of the user are more than or equal to the set times, deleting the Bluetooth pairing information of the set top box and the Bluetooth remote controller stored in the set top box. For example, the set number of times is set to 3, the bluetooth remote controller which has established bluetooth connection with the set-top box is the remote controller a, namely the original bluetooth remote controller, the user loses the remote controller a during use, then a new bluetooth remote controller is replaced, namely the remote controller B, the current user deletes the bluetooth pairing information of the set-top box and the remote controller a by plugging and unplugging the signal connection line of the set-top box, namely the user repeatedly performs plugging and unplugging of the HDMI cable from the HDMI cable plugging port and unplugging of the HDMI cable into the HDMI cable plugging port, the detected plugging and unplugging action number is 3, and as the action number is equal to the set number of times, the condition for deleting the bluetooth pairing information is determined to be satisfied, and then the bluetooth pairing information of the set-top box and the remote controller a is deleted from the set-top box. And then, the user can operate the remote controller B to pair with the set-top box, so that the Bluetooth connection between the remote controller B and the set-top box is established, and then the set-top box is operated by using the remote controller B.
According to the technical scheme, the Bluetooth pairing information stored in the set top box is deleted in a mode of plugging and unplugging the signal connecting line connected to the set top box when the Bluetooth remote controller which is connected with the set top box through Bluetooth cannot operate the set top box, so that a user can conveniently reuse a new Bluetooth remote controller to establish Bluetooth connection with the set top box, and use the new Bluetooth remote controller to operate the set top box.
As shown in fig. 3, in the second embodiment of the present application, the method for deleting bluetooth pairing information further includes the following steps:
step S210: and detecting the action times of plugging and unplugging the signal connecting line into the set top box.
Step S220: judging whether the action times are more than or equal to the set times, if so, executing the step S221; if not, the process returns to step S210.
Step S221: and starting timing, namely timing the preset time.
Step S222: judging whether a key instruction of the Bluetooth remote controller is received within a preset time, if not, executing step S230; if so, the process returns to step S221.
Step S230: and deleting the Bluetooth pairing information of the set top box and the Bluetooth remote controller stored in the set top box.
In order to avoid that a user repairs the set top box or the television and does not want to delete the bluetooth pairing information stored in the set top box, in this embodiment, a preset time and a prompt are set before the bluetooth pairing information stored in the set top box is deleted, that is, when the number of times of the plugging and unplugging actions of the user plugging and unplugging signal connection line is detected to be greater than or equal to the set number of times, the preset time is timed and the prompt is performed, for example, the preset time is counted down, the bluetooth pairing information stored in the set top box is prompted to be deleted, and then whether a key instruction of the bluetooth remote controller is received within the preset time is judged. The user is prompted to quit the operation of deleting the Bluetooth pairing information stored in the set top box by pressing any key of the Bluetooth remote controller within the preset time, and if a key instruction of the Bluetooth remote controller is received within the preset time, the operation of deleting the Bluetooth pairing information stored in the set top box is quitted; and if the key instruction of the Bluetooth remote controller is not received within the preset time, deleting the Bluetooth pairing information stored in the set top box after the preset time is up.
Further, the manner of enabling the timing includes: and sending an information deletion prompting instruction to display equipment connected with the set top box so that the display equipment can display an information deletion prompting interface according to the information deletion prompting instruction, and setting the preset time in the information deletion prompting interface.
Specifically, when detecting that the number of times of plugging and unplugging actions of plugging and unplugging the signal connecting line by a user is greater than or equal to the set number of times, the set top box sends an information deletion prompting instruction to a display device such as a television, the television displays an information deletion prompting interface according to the information deletion prompting instruction, and the preset time is set on the information deletion prompting interface. For example, the information deletion prompting interface displays that the bluetooth pairing information stored in the set top box is to be deleted within preset time, the preset time starts to count down, if the preset time is not counted down yet and a key instruction of the bluetooth remote controller is received, the information deletion prompting interface is exited, and the bluetooth pairing information is not deleted; and if the countdown of the preset time is finished, the key instruction of the Bluetooth remote controller is not received, and the Bluetooth pairing information is deleted.
According to the technical scheme, when the action times of the plugging and unplugging action of the plugging and unplugging signal connecting wire of the user meet the deleting condition of the Bluetooth pairing information stored in the set top box, the user can be reminded in time, and the situation that the Bluetooth pairing information is deleted due to the fact that the user does not want to delete the plugging and unplugging operation of the Bluetooth pairing information stored in the set top box is avoided.
Further, when detecting that the number of times of the plugging and unplugging actions of plugging and unplugging the signal connection line by the user is greater than or equal to the set number of times, deleting the bluetooth pairing information of the set top box and the bluetooth remote controller stored in the set top box comprises: when the action times are larger than or equal to the set times, detecting whether the signal connecting line is inserted into a line inserting port of the set top box or not; and when the signal connecting line is inserted into the plug wire port, deleting the Bluetooth pairing information.
Specifically, sometimes, when the user plugs or unplugs the signal connection line, the plugging operation is already more than the set number of times, it may happen that the user forgets something temporary or for other reasons does not timely replace the signal connection line in the jack, therefore, the plugging action corresponding to the plugging times exceeding the set times is incomplete, that is, the plugging action corresponding to the plugging times exceeding the set times is only the action of plugging out the signal connection wire, and no action of plugging in the signal connection wire, so even if the plugging action is greater than the set times, but when the plugging and unplugging actions corresponding to the plugging and unplugging times exceeding the set times are incomplete, the Bluetooth pairing information is not deleted, and when the plugging and unplugging action is greater than the set times and the plugging and unplugging action corresponding to the plugging and unplugging times exceeding the set times is a complete action, deleting the Bluetooth pairing information stored in the set top box. Therefore, after the signal connecting line is plugged by a user, the signal connecting line is always plugged into the plug wire port, and the television can be normally used.
As shown in fig. 4, in the third embodiment of the present application, the method for deleting bluetooth pairing information further includes the following steps:
step S110: when a Bluetooth pairing instruction is detected, prompt information for plugging and unplugging the signal connecting wire is sent.
Step S120: and detecting whether the plugging and unplugging action of plugging and unplugging the signal connecting lines occurs, and detecting the action times of plugging and unplugging the signal connecting lines of the set top box when the plugging and unplugging action of plugging and unplugging the signal connecting lines occurs.
Considering that the user does not know in advance that the set-top box has a function of deleting the bluetooth pairing information of the set-top box and the bluetooth remote controller stored in the set-top box by repeatedly plugging and unplugging the signal connection line of the set-top box, the embodiment sets the prompt information, which is used for prompting the user how to delete the bluetooth pairing information of the set-top box and the bluetooth remote controller stored in the set-top box by voice or characters on the television, for example, the prompt information is "please unplug the HDMI cable of the set-top box from the HDMI cable plug port, then quickly reinsert the HDMI cable into the HDMI cable plug port again, and thus repeatedly operate for 3 times or more than 3 times".
Specifically, if the bluetooth remote controller which has established bluetooth connection with the set top box cannot be used (if lost or damaged), the user buys a new bluetooth remote controller, when the user uses the new bluetooth remote controller to perform bluetooth pairing with the set top box, the bluetooth remote controller sends a bluetooth pairing instruction to the set top box, and when the set top box detects the bluetooth pairing instruction, the set top box sends prompt information for plugging and unplugging a signal connection line, namely the user is prompted to delete the bluetooth pairing information of the set top box and the bluetooth remote controller which is stored in the set top box in a mode of repeatedly plugging and unplugging the signal connection line of the set top box. Then, whether the plugging action of plugging and unplugging the signal connecting line occurs is detected, if the plugging action of plugging and unplugging the signal connecting line is detected, step S210 is executed to detect the action times of plugging and unplugging the signal connecting line of the set-top box. The Bluetooth pairing instruction is sent by another Bluetooth remote controller which is different from the Bluetooth remote controller which establishes Bluetooth connection with the set top box, and it can be understood that the Bluetooth remote controller which establishes Bluetooth connection with the set top box is a remote controller A, a new Bluetooth remote controller bought by a user is a remote controller B, and because the remote controller A cannot be used, when the user performs Bluetooth pairing with the set top box through the remote controller B, the Bluetooth pairing instruction detected by the set top box is sent by the remote controller B.
Further, detecting whether the plugging and unplugging action of the signal connecting line occurs includes: acquiring a level signal of a plug wire port of the set top box; and when the level signal changes repeatedly, determining that the plugging and unplugging action of plugging and unplugging the signal connecting wire occurs.
Whether the plugging and unplugging action of the plugging and unplugging signal connecting wire occurs or not can be judged through the level signal of the plug wire port, namely the plugging and unplugging action of the plugging and unplugging signal connecting wire is determined to occur when the level signal changes repeatedly. For example, when the signal connection line is inserted into the jack, the level signal of the jack is at a low level, and when the signal connection line is pulled out of the jack, the level signal of the jack is at a high level, and the level signal at the jack changes from a low level to a high level, and then from the high level to the low level, it is determined that the pulling and inserting operation of the signal connection line is to occur.
As shown in fig. 5, in the fourth embodiment of the present application, step S210 includes the steps of:
step S211: and acquiring the interval time between the signal connecting line being pulled out of the plug wire port and the signal connecting line being inserted into the plug wire port.
Step S212: and when the interval time is less than or equal to the set time, counting the number of times of pulling out the signal connecting wire from the plug wire port and the number of times of inserting the signal connecting wire into the plug wire port.
Step S213: and determining the action times according to the pulling-out times and the inserting times.
In this embodiment, the signal connection line is pulled out of the plug port, and then the signal connection line is inserted into the plug port. Specifically, when it is determined that the interval between the signal connection line being pulled out of the jack and the signal connection line being inserted into the jack is shorter than or equal to the set time, the pulling and inserting operation is performed once, that is, the number of times of the pulling and inserting operation is one. It can also be understood that the signal connection line is pulled out of the socket and the pulling out corresponds to the number of pulling out operations, and the signal connection line is inserted into the socket and the inserting operation corresponds to the number of inserting operations. If the user does not touch the set-top box, the signal connecting line is inserted into the plug wire port, when the user pulls the signal connecting line out of the plug wire port and then inserts the signal connecting line into the plug wire port, namely, the pulling-out times are once, the inserting times are also once, and the interval time between the current pulling-out of the signal connecting line and the current inserting of the signal connecting line is less than or equal to the set time, the action time of the current plugging-pulling action can be determined to be once; if the operation of pulling out the signal connecting wire from the plug wire port and then inserting the signal connecting wire into the plug wire port is repeatedly executed for three times, and the interval time of pulling out the signal connecting wire and inserting the signal connecting wire each time is less than or equal to the set time, the action times of the plugging action are four times in total.
The time intervals for pulling out the signal connecting lines and inserting the signal connecting lines can be obtained according to the pulling-out time for pulling out the plug wire ports from the signal connecting lines and the inserting time for inserting the signal connecting lines into the plug wire ports, the corresponding time can be recorded when the signal connecting lines are pulled out of the plug wire ports and the signal connecting lines are inserted into the plug wire ports at each time, namely when the signal connecting lines are pulled out of the plug wire ports, the pulling-out time for pulling out the signal connecting lines from the plug wire ports can be recorded, and when the signal connecting lines are inserted into the plug wire ports, the inserting time for inserting the signal connecting lines into the plug wire ports can be recorded. The insertion time is later than the extraction time, namely the time difference obtained by the difference between the insertion time and the extraction time each time is the interval time.
